Webgigabyte (GB): A gigabyte (GB) is a measure of computer data storage capacity that is roughly equivalent to 1 billion bytes . A gigabyte is two to the 30th power or 1,073,741,824 in decimal notation. The term is pronounced with two hard Gs. The prefix giga comes from a Greek word meaning giant .
